📖 Key Scripture Verses
Matthew 18:15–20 – The biblical pathway to reconciliation
Ephesians 4:15, 30–32 – Truth in love and protecting unity
Matthew 6:14–15 – Jesus’ command to forgive
Romans 12:1 – Forgiveness as a living sacrifice
